Oxford Lane Capital Corp. 8.75% Notes due 2030 (OXLCI), an exchange-traded corporate note issued by business development company Oxford Lane Capital Corp., trades at $25.75 as of May 6, 2026, posting a modest 0.16% intraday gain. This analysis outlines key technical levels, recent market context, and potential scenarios for the security, which offers a fixed 8.75% coupon and matures in 2030. Market Context

OXLCI has seen normal trading activity this month, with no sharp volume spikes or sustained drops that would signal large, unannounced institutional positioning shifts. The security trades within the broader BDC debt and investment-grade corporate note segment, which has seen muted volatility in recent weeks as market participants weigh incoming macroeconomic data to gauge the trajectory of monetary policy. Fixed income securities like OXLCI are particularly sensitive to interest rate expectations, as changes in benchmark rates can impact the relative attractiveness of their fixed coupon payments compared to newly issued debt. Recent public market analysis focused on OXLCI has noted the security’s consistent trading range amid broader fixed income market uncertainty, as investors prioritize predictable income streams amid shifting macroeconomic conditions. Technical Analysis

As of the current trading session, OXLCI has established clear, well-tested technical levels that market participants are monitoring closely. Near-term support sits at $24.46, a price point that has held during multiple pullbacks in recent weeks, with buyers consistently stepping in to absorb supply near that threshold. On the upside, the security faces defined near-term resistance at $27.04, a level that has capped multiple rally attempts in recent trading sessions, as sellers have emerged to take profits near that price. From a momentum perspective, OXLCI’s relative strength index (RSI) is currently in the mid-40s, indicating neutral near-term momentum with no extreme overbought or oversold conditions that would signal an imminent trend shift. Short-term moving averages are trading very close to the current $25.75 price, reflecting a lack of strong directional conviction among market participants, while longer-term moving averages sit slightly below the current price, potentially offering an additional layer of underlying support if prices drift lower in the coming sessions. Outlook

Looking ahead, market participants will likely monitor OXLCI’s key support and resistance levels for signals of a potential shift in near-term sentiment. A sustained move above the $27.04 resistance level, particularly if accompanied by higher-than-normal trading volume, could signal improving demand for the security, potentially opening up a broader trading range to the upside. Conversely, a sustained break below the $24.46 support level might indicate weakening investor confidence, potentially leading to further near-term price pressure. Beyond technical factors, OXLCI’s performance will likely be influenced by broader macroeconomic trends, particularly shifts in market expectations for monetary policy, as changes in benchmark interest rates could impact the relative value of its fixed 8.75% coupon. Analysts estimate that continued stable credit performance from Oxford Lane Capital Corp. could provide fundamental support for the note’s price, while any unexpected changes to the issuer’s credit profile or broader credit market conditions could introduce additional volatility. In upcoming weeks, participants will also monitor new regulatory filings from Oxford Lane Capital Corp. for updates that could impact the security’s risk profile.
